## Contractor First Week — Building Access

Team assistants coordinating a contractor's first week at Pellworth Yard should book their induction before day one, escort them until their temporary badge is issued (usually day two), and log all site areas they'll need. Tool deliveries go via the goods lift only. Until the badge arrives, contractors enter through the side door using the code below.

turnstile pass: bdg-YPPQB-52010

## Key Ceremony Checklist — Item 7 (Weekly Eng Sync)

Confirm the Brightgate canary gating rules are signed before rotation: error-budget threshold at 0.5%, rollback window at 15 minutes, and promotion quorum of two approvers. Witnesses verify the signing key fingerprint aloud. Once verified, the ceremony lead unseals the gating-policy store using the recovery passphrase recorded below.

vault phrase of hawif-bahof = novvan-belius-istael-fenvan-holdor-druox-eliath

## Deployment

The Gallerina audio-guide backend deploys to the Hollowmere Museum's on-prem cluster via the `shipwright` CLI. Before your first deploy, confirm you can reach the staging node from the curators' VPN segment; the exhibit-sync worker will refuse to start otherwise. Always deploy staging first, walk the Whispering Hall test tour end to end, and only then promote to production. The service reads its settings at boot and will not hot-reload. The current configuration values are listed below.

deployment values, yafog-tahop:
ZOROK_PIN=9451
ZOROK_TENANT=novael
ZOROK_METRICS_HOST=metrics.zorok.crelvocloud.corp
ZOROK_SEAL=seal_8d0b0d39
ZOROK_STANDBY_TEAM=jorir

**Ticket VRAM-412: gpuprof reports negative free memory after pool reset**

Repro steps:
1. Launch the Thornbeck profiler against any workload using pooled allocations.
2. Trigger a pool reset mid-capture (`gpuprof --reset-pools`).
3. Check the summary pane — free memory goes negative.

Looks like the reset path decrements the counter twice. Patch attached; please review the accounting change in `pool_tracker.c`. To pull traces from the staging collector, use the token below.

login token, bagug-kafop: eyJhbGciOiJIUzI1NiIsInR5cCI6IkpXVCJ9.eyJzdWIiOiIcMLov2In0.Z5RLDIfp